Why Does My Nut Butter Stall When Blending?

adjust temperature and speed

When blending nut butter, it’s common to notice the process stalls or slows down unexpectedly. This often happens because the nuts are too dry or cold, making the mixture thick and difficult to process. If your nut butter stalls, check your nut butter storage—if it’s been in the fridge, it might be too firm. Let it sit at room temperature for a few minutes before blending again. You’ll also notice increased blender noise when the motor struggles against the thick mixture. To help things along, pause and scrape down the sides, add a splash of oil or a small amount of warm liquid, and blend gradually. These steps can make your nut butter smoother and prevent the blender from overheating or stalling. How Do Temperature and Oil Content Affect Nut Butter Texture?

temperature oil nut butter

Temperature and oil content play crucial roles in determining the texture of your nut butter. When the temperature rises, it softens the nuts, making blending smoother and reducing the risk of stalls. Conversely, cooler ingredients can cause stubborn texture issues. Proper temperature control helps you achieve consistent results and prevents undesirable textures. Warming the nuts slightly before blending can significantly improve their blendability, especially when working with harder varieties. Oil content also impacts creaminess; higher oil levels generally lead to a more spreadable, silky consistency, while lower oil content results in a thicker, chunkier texture. Understanding temperature effects helps you control the process—warming nuts slightly can help them blend more smoothly. Additionally, adjusting oil content by adding a bit of neutral oil can improve creaminess. Keep in mind that too much oil might make your nut butter overly greasy, but the right balance creates a smooth, luscious spread.

Does Blender Power and Blade Design Make a Difference?

blender power and blade

The power of your blender and its blade design can substantially influence how smoothly and efficiently your nut butter comes together. A stronger motor provides the necessary torque to break down tough nuts without overheating or stalling, especially when processing larger quantities. Blade shape also matters—wide, flat blades help push nuts toward the center, ensuring even blending, while sharp, pointed blades can better chop and pulverize stubborn pieces. If your blender has limited motor strength or poorly designed blades, you’ll likely experience uneven textures or prolonged processing times. Upgrading to a blender with higher wattage and a thoughtfully designed blade can make a noticeable difference, helping you achieve a creamier, more consistent nut butter faster and with less frustration. Preparing Nuts and Adding Ingredients for Better Blending Results

proper nut preparation techniques

To guarantee your nut butter blends smoothly, start by preparing your nuts properly. Toast lightly to enhance flavor development, which brings out deeper nutty notes and improves overall taste. Roasting also helps release oils, making blending easier. Be sure to cool nuts before adding them to the blender to prevent excess heat that can degrade nutrients. When adding ingredients like oil or sweeteners, do so gradually and in small amounts to aid smooth blending and maintain nutrient retention. Using Scraping and Pulsing Techniques to Improve Texture

scrape pulse and blend

Using scraping and pulsing techniques can substantially improve the texture of your nut butter. When you hit a nut butter stall, stopping to scrape down the sides of your blender helps redistribute ingredients and prevent uneven blending. Pulsing prevents overheating and keeps control over the consistency, avoiding overprocessing. Here are key blender techniques to enhance your results:

Scraping and pulsing keep nut butter smooth, prevent stalls, and ensure creamy, even results.

  • Regularly scrape the sides of the blender container
  • Use short, controlled pulses instead of continuous blending
  • Pause between pulses to check texture
  • Apply gentle pressure to encourage movement
  • Incorporate additional oil if needed for smoother blending

These methods keep your nut butter moving evenly, reducing stalls and helping it turn creamy faster. Mastering scraping and pulsing guarantees you get a silky, well-blended spread without frustration.

Oil Separation Dynamics

Oil separation in nut butter occurs because natural oils tend to migrate to the surface over time, especially when the mixture isn’t stabilized. Factors like storage conditions and nut variety influence this process. Poor storage, such as exposure to heat or air, accelerates oil separation. Different nut varieties have varying oil content, affecting how quickly separation occurs. You might notice a layer of oil on top, which can seem sudden. To understand this better, consider:

  • How temperature fluctuations impact oil movement
  • The natural oil content in different nuts
  • The role of minimal stirring before storage
  • The effect of longer storage periods
  • The importance of mixing to redistribute oils

Recognizing these factors helps you predict and manage oil separation, keeping your nut butter creamy longer.

Temperature Fluctuations Impact

Temperature fluctuations can cause nut butter to suddenly turn creamy, even after it has remained stable for weeks. When the ambient or storage temperature shifts, it affects the nut temperature inside the jar, impacting its blending consistency. Cooler conditions make the nut butter firmer, while warmer temperatures soften it, allowing it to become more spreadable. If you’ve stored your nut butter in a fluctuating environment, these changes can cause the texture to shift unexpectedly. When the nut temperature increases, the oils loosen, creating a smoother, creamier consistency. Conversely, cooler temperatures can cause the oils to solidify temporarily, making it feel less creamy. These temperature-driven changes are often subtle but can dramatically influence how your nut butter behaves when you blend or spread it.

Frequently Asked Questions

Can Using Roasted vs. Raw Nuts Affect Blending Results?

Using roasted nuts in your blender can improve blending results and flavor enhancement, making the nut butter creamier faster. Roasting nut roasting breaks down oils and cell walls, which helps the nuts release more oil, aiding in smoother blending. Raw nuts, on the other hand, may take longer and require more patience. So, if you want a more creamy consistency, opt for roasted nuts for better results and richer flavor.

Is There an Ideal Nut-To-Oil Ratio for Creamy Butter?

Imagine the nut-to-oil ratio as the perfect dance partner’s balance—too much oil and it’s too slick; too little and it’s too stiff. For ideal consistency, aim for about 2:1 or 3:1 nuts to oil. This balance helps your blender create smooth, creamy nut butter. Adjust slightly based on your nuts’ dryness or oiliness, but stick close to these ratios for the best results.
